WebApr 13, 2024 · Correct spelling, explanation: sincerely comes from the Latin language and, more precisely, from the word sincerus, which used to mean pure or clean. The word appeared in English in the 16th century and back then it had the form sincere and the meaning of not falsified. Today sincerely is an adverb used mainly in formal contexts.

WebYours sincerely Your’s Though you may see your’s written even by native speakers, it is incorrect. Yours should never have an apostrophe. The Bottom Line The idea that yours needs an apostrophe comes out of the fact that on virtually every other word, ‘s indicates possession, so English speakers sometimes think yours should be spelled your’s. Sincerely yours is a standard sign-off, used to end an email or letter, followed by your name on the next line. “Sincerely” is an adverb meaning “genuinely” and is used to emphasize your honest intentions toward the person addressed.
